ITU-R SM.1840

Test procedure for measuring the sensitivity of radio monitoring receivers using analogue-modulated signals

scope:

This Recommendation belongs to a set of Recommendations describing the test methods to determine technical parameters of radio monitoring receivers that are important for the users of these receivers. When the described methods are followed by manufacturers, comparing different receivers is made easier. This Recommendation provides the definition of a sensitivity test procedure for receivers. This test procedure definition is recommended to all the manufacturers, with the advantage for the users of such receivers, that an easier and more objective assessment of product quality is possible.
